Astronomer empowers data teams to bring mission-critical software, analytics, and AI to life and is the company behind Astro, the industry-leading unified DataOps platform powered by Apache Airflow®. Astro accelerates building reliable data products that unlock insights, unleash AI value, and powers data-driven applications. Trusted by more than 800 of the world's leading enterprises, Astronomer lets businesses do more with their data. To learn more, visit www.astronomer.io.

About this role:

As a Cloud Solutions Architect, you will join our field team to deliver world-class technical solutions to customer and prospect business problems. In this role, you will be exposed to a wide range of use cases where Apache Airflow sits at the center of the solution.

The impacts you will make will enable customers to rapidly grow their businesses by adopting Astronomer products to meet their goals.

What you get to do:
  • Implement Astronomer’s software and services in the core of some of the world’s largest businesses and organizations.

  • Guide our largest and most complex customers in their Apache Airflow journeys

  • Act as the core interface between the Customer, Sales, and Product to ensure that the broader solution around the platform is solving pain points and bringing value to customers.

What you bring to the role:
  • Strong Kubernetes experience (GKE/EKS/AKS or OpenShift preferred)

  • Expertise in at least one programming language.

  • Good understanding of network complexities and architectures

  • Versatile Terminal and CLI user, this will be a hands-on role, frequently without access to a GUI

  • Experience setting up and troubleshooting distributed systems

  • Experience with complex SaaS infrastructure operating at scale

  • Experience with at least one major cloud provider API/tooling

  • Ability to read code

  • Work effectively with git

  • Cloud-native data architecture experience

  • Strong customer facing skills

  • Strong oral and written communications skills - should be able to explain complex technical issues to non-technical folks succinctly

Bonus points if you have:
  • Prior experience using or administering Apache Airflow, Autosys, UC4, Temporal, Dagster, or Prefect

  • Proficiency in Python/Go.

  • Enterprise data experience with or in regulated environments

  • Experience with scripting/automation specifically infra (Pulumi, Terraform, Ansible, etc.)

  • 5+ years experience in a data engineering role or equivalent

  • 3+ years in a customer-facing role

  • Experience with ElasticSearch/Prometheus/Vault
